From fdb895e02643dc6128b5ec28369dab58f8286761 Mon Sep 17 00:00:00 2001
From: liuxiaolong <736321739@qq.com>
Date: 星期三, 29 五月 2019 20:18:56 +0800
Subject: [PATCH] post add timeout
---
esutil/EsClient.go | 5 ++++-
1 files changed, 4 insertions(+), 1 deletions(-)
diff --git a/esutil/EsClient.go b/esutil/EsClient.go
index e01cd14..2bd3650 100644
--- a/esutil/EsClient.go
+++ b/esutil/EsClient.go
@@ -298,7 +298,10 @@
request.Header.Add(key, val)
}
}
- client := &http.Client{}
+ timeOut:= time.Duration(8*time.Second)//set request timeout
+ client := &http.Client{
+ Timeout:timeOut,
+ }
resp, err := client.Do(request)
if err != nil {
return resultBytes, err
--
Gitblit v1.8.0